Scottish Farmers will get their first look at New Holland’s recently launched T5 Utility tractor range alongside its latest round and square baler models at the Royal Highland Show.

New Holland has added a further five models to its T5 range of tractors to complete the mid-range tractor line up. The latest Utility models offer between 75 and 114 hp and continue the heritage of New Holland’s well-regarded T5000 series - 24x24 Dual Command transmission, capable performance and compact size, and all at a competitive price.   

The larger, three model T5 Tier 4B Electro Command range launched in 2016, offers between 99 and 117hp with a semi powershift ElectroCommand™ transmission, upgraded styling and optional cab and axle suspension.    

New T5 Utility tractors can be specified with a choice of two- or four-wheel drive on all Synchro-Shuttle models (four-wheel drive on all others), plus a wide choice of transmissions including Dual Command, Power Shuttle, and Creep-speed to suit individual requirements.

Loader-ready, the T5 can support a maximum lift capacity of up to 2,539kg with a maximum lifting height of 3.7m from New Holland’s 740TL front loader. For added versatility a front linkage is also available, offering a lift capacity of 1,670 kg combined with a 1000-speed PTO.

Rear lift capacity is impressive, with a maximum of 4,400kg with a second assist ram. A three-speed PTO featuring ECO and ground speed increases the number of implements that can be used and reduces fuel consumption.

And New Holland hasn’t forgotten the operator either. In the spacious VisionViewTM cab, drivers benefit from an ergonomic control layout, a choice of seats and air conditioning, along with a full width high visibility roof panel for improved safety, particularly when operating a front loader. The Heavy Duty (class 1.5) front axle, available on the T5.95, 105 and 115, gives greater load carrying capacity, also enhancing these tractors for loader work.

Alongside the first Scottish showing of the New Holland T5 Utility tractor, the extensively renewed and upgraded RollBaler 125 and BigBaler 1290 Plus models will be on display at the Royal Highland Show.

The RollBaler 125 offers the best choice in fixed round chamber baling for silage or straw - even when working with heavy grass, dense hay or large, dry, brittle straw swaths.

Boasting a new, wider pick-up measuring 2.3m, giving an additional 10 cm on the previous model, the RollBaler 125 delivers best-in-class efficiency. A new, advanced roller reduces crop losses even in dry conditions, ensuring consistent and superior bale density.

The new flagship BigBaler 1290 Plus is New Holland’s largest, square baler yet and has a host of unique features. From IntelliCruiseTM technology for tractor ground speed regulation to its SmartFillTM feed flow indicators for even bale formation, it is worthy of its best-in-class titles.

Nothing is left behind when using the BigBaler 1290 Plus. The new biomass kit makes short work of stiff and stalky biomass material and the MaxiSweepTM pick-up design improves productivity over high tonnage windrows. The BigBaler 1290 Plus raises the bar on durability and reliability, with improved wear resistance and easier maintenance for reduced stoppages.
